Subject: Marketing budget trim — heads up

Hi all,

Quick one before Thursday's sync: we're pulling marketing spend down 15% for the Lanternfish launch, effective next month. Paid channels take most of the hit; events survive mostly intact. Odette's team will re-forecast pipeline impact by Friday, so don't panic-adjust your targets yet. If a regional campaign is mid-flight, flag it to me directly. The reasoning ties to the note below.

board note of bahif-yajef: Only 9 of the 120 pilot accounts renewed Oliwyn, so a churn review is set for January 1.

### Runbook: Proctorline queue release

Before approving the deploy, confirm the candidate tag passed the exam-session replay suite and that queue depth metrics on the Corvally staging cluster returned to baseline after the soak test. The reviewer is responsible for checking that the worker image digest matches the signed manifest. Signing is performed manually for this service; the release manifest must be signed with the key provided below.

signing key of fahof-tahof = bky13_rpcUNgEnLB4i2

## Changelog — StockMend reconciliation job

As of release 4.12, the nightly inventory reconciliation in StockMend defaults to incremental mode rather than full-table scans. This cuts runtime roughly 70% but means stale rows older than 14 days require a manual full pass. If you are paged for drift alerts, verify the mode before rerunning. The current production settings are listed below.

deployment values, bahop-yadug:
[caswyn]
port = 8443
region = east-4
host = caswyn.lumicworks.internal
timeout_ms = 5000
retries = 8

Welcome aboard. The Brightmere pilot in the Astwell region has lost 14 of 90 enrolled customers since launch, concentrated in the first sixty days. Exit interviews point to onboarding friction rather than pricing; the revised walkthrough introduced last month appears to be helping, though sample sizes remain small. Meryl Dossett runs retention analysis and will brief you weekly. Please review the churn cohort file before your first steering meeting. The following context is strictly confidential.

confidential, hahop-bajep: Gross margin on Ralath came in at 5 percent against a plan of 10 percent. Only 9 of the 100 pilot accounts renewed Ralath, so a churn review is set for April 1.